Smokescreen's gone... Is that good or bad?

So I was getting too much of a clatter from my engine, like you throw a bunch of metal balls into the engine, and putting in new injector nozzles fixed that. As a byproduct, however, I noticed that one of my favorite features in a diesel, which is the smokescreen (you know, someone follows you a bit too close, you step on it and they immediately keep their distance for the rest of the journey) is gone... I've been trying to get it out, as tailgating is one of the favorite activities for drivers here in Utah, and I can see no smoke... nor does the tailgater, much to my chagrin. Now I have to slow down if I want to get rid of a tailgater. Is this almost total abscence of smoke normal or is this a sign of not too good things to come in my engine?
